How To Restrict Friends On Facebook


Visit the Facebook profile page of the person you desire to add to your limited list. Click the "Buddies" drop-down box that appears at the bottom right of their cover photo. Select the choice "Add to another list."

Now, click on the "Limited" setting that appears on the next menu. This should enbolden the text and put a check mark beside it.

Now, when you next post content, you can chose whether you desire it to be public content or just for the eyes of your Facebook pals.

To alter this personal privacy setting as you publish, click on the drop-down box at the bottom of your pending post and select the alternative that matches your content.

If you select "Buddies", the people on your limited list will not see the post. If you choose "Public," they will.

This is a good technique of making sure particular individuals just see posts you're prepared to make public.
